Job Description

An Insight Global client is currently looking for a Sr. Construction Project Manager to join their team. This individual will be responsible for:
• Lead and manage end-to-end data center construction projects, from early construction phases through commissioning and customer handoff.
• Oversee all construction trades, ensuring timelines, quality, and safety standards are met.
• Manage supply chain logistics, including material procurement, delivery scheduling, and vendor coordination.
• Own construction execution through core & shell completion, followed by full oversight of:
○ Mechanical systems
○ Electrical infrastructure
○ Network and technology installations
• Coordinate closely with internal teams and external contractors to deliver projects on time and within budget.
• Transition from base build into tenant improvements (TI) / customer fit-out projects, managing multiple workstreams simultaneously.
• Track project progress, risks, and changes using project management platforms and reports for leadership visibility.
• Serve as a senior point of contact for construction execution across internal stakeholders and executive leadership.

Required Skills & Experience

• Demonstrated ownership of at least one 50+ MW data center construction project
(Must have directly managed the project, not supported as part of a team).
• 5+ years of experience as a Construction Project Manager on large-scale, complex builds.
• PMP certification required.
• Strong background in mechanical construction, particularly within data center environments.
• Proven ability to manage multiple trades, aggressive schedules, and complex stakeholder groups.

Nice to Have Skills & Experience

• Experience using Procore for construction and project management.
• Exposure to BIM modeling workflows.
• Familiarity with RediT / reporting or construction analytics tools.
